Traditional Tales Of The English And Scottish Peasantry is a collection of folk tales and legends compiled by Scottish author Allan Cunningham. The book contains a variety of stories, including supernatural tales, legends of heroes and villains, and humorous anecdotes. These stories were passed down orally through generations and were originally told by the English and Scottish peasantry. Cunningham's collection includes stories such as ""Tam Lin"", ""The Brownie of Bodsbeck"", and ""The Witch of Fife"". The book provides insight into the rich cultural history of the British Isles and the beliefs and traditions of its people.
